Dietary Supplements Lawsuit Over FDA Regulations
From FDA Law Blog:
Alliance for Natural Health Sues FDA to Invalidate Dietary Supplement CGMPs By Ricardo Carvajal & JP Ellison –
It’s been a busy month at the Alliance for Natural Health. In addition to suing FDA over its handling of health claims, the Alliance (in conjunction with other plaintiffs) has sued FDA to invalidate certain provisions of the agency’s Current Good Manufacturing Practice (“CGMP”) regulation for dietary supplements.
